Order 5735-6 Complete!

Hello Kitty Sega Dreamcast (VA1) came in for a full refurb!

- Japanese CAKE BIOS Install
- Full Recap Service (MB/GDROM/PSU)
- New ML2032 & Socket
- Resettable Fuse
- GDROM Cleaning & Lube
- Fan Cleaning & Oil
- New Thermals

We've been talking more people into getting hall effect sticks, so we've been messing with them more. Interestingly unlike carbon circuit potentiometers, hall effect pots are not interoperable between controllers.

Order #4828 Complete!

Customer sent in their platinum GameCube for some nice upgrades!

- Picoboot install
- Noctua Fan Upgrade
- Swappable battery holder/fresh battery
- New Thermal pads
